Kusadasi Pigeon Island and Old Town tours work well for visitors who want to understand the port town itself before choosing longer day trips. The route can connect the cruise port or town center with Guvercinada, harbor views, marina atmosphere, Kaleici streets, local cafes, boutiques and short photo stops. It is especially useful for travelers with limited time or those who prefer a local city orientation.

Pigeon Island, also known as Guvercinada, is one of the clearest visual anchors for Kusadasi. Some products may use it as a photo stop, harbor-view point or short city-route feature where supported. Travelers should check whether the route reaches the island area, stays around the harbor, allows free time or only uses the landmark as part of a wider town orientation.

Old Town and Kaleici details feel local rather than archaeological. The strongest angles are streets, cafes, shops, marina proximity, seafront mood and practical port access.
